Kevin Mier after David Ospina in the ranking of young champion goalkeepers in Colombia | Colombian Soccer | Betplay League

The champion archer with National Athletic, Kevin Leonardo Mier, has already established himself in the history of Colombian soccer not only because of the 17th star he conquered with the purslane, but also because he became one of the youngest in his position, reaching a title. After David Ospinawho kissed the trophy in 2007 at just 19 years old, the one who is second on that list is the one born in Barrancabermeja.

Mier, who has just turned 22, was one of the great figures in the Nacional title and not only because of what he did in the final against Deportes Tolima, where he saved Daniel Cataño from a penalty, but because he was key in several games of the tournament. Kevin played 28 games, made 12 clean sheets and played the last 12 League games without changing positions.

Transfermarkt recently highlighted what was done by the 22-year-old goalkeeper, who entered a select group of young goalkeepers to reach the title in Colombia. After Ospina, Mier appears as the second youngest to achieve it.

In the 27 championships between David’s 2007-II title and Kevin’s 2022-I, only three 23-year-old goalkeepers managed to be crowned champions. They are Camilo Vargas, who achieved it with Santa Fe in 2012-I, Álvaro Montero with Deportes Tolima in 2018-I and Joel Graterol with América in the 2020 League.
